The BTC Insights
Bitcoin Calculator stands apart from its peers due to two distinct capabilities. Firstly, it transcends the traditional functionality of Bitcoin calculators by offering users the ability to select not just a strategy for investing in Bitcoin (DCA in), but also a method for selling their holdings (DCA out).

The DCA in feature allows users to specify a recurring investment plan, such as weekly or monthly purchases, which can help mitigate the volatility inherent in the cryptocurrency market. This strategy fosters dollar-cost averaging, ensuring that investors can accumulate
Bitcoin over time at an average price.
